Cpm rex m4 hc high speed steel is an extremely versatile high speed steel that provides a unique combination of high wear resistance with high impact toughness and transverse bend strength.
M4 is an extremely versatile high speed steel with its extremely high carbon and vanadium contents for exceptional abrasion resistance.
Pm m4 is a molybdenum tungsten high speed steel produced using the pm powdered metal steel making process.
The machinability of m4 steels is comparatively low rating about 40 than that of water hardening tool steels which are much easier to machine.
Heat treatment m4 steels can be preheated at 788 c 1450 f and then rapidly heated to 1218 c 2224 f for 3 5 minutes followed by oil salt bath or air quenching process.
The grade has an excellent balance of toughness and wear resistance making it ideal for cutting tools and for cold work tooling.
A large volume of vanadium carbides provides the high wear resistance.
